Summary: misspelling in User Edit page
Original Submission: in the user edit page, where passwd, pereemissions, and
acls are set for an individual user, the link to edit the addressbook entry for
a user is misspelled.
it is spelled: Edit Entrie
should be spelled: Edit Entry
clearly a late night coding flub, no worries, no rush.
